Abstract

This paper presents a power-aware scheduling policy algorithm of Virtual Machines into nodes called Green Cloud (GreenC) for Heterogeneous cloud systems. GreenC takes into account optimal assignments according to physical and virtual machine heterogeneity, the current host workload and communication between the different virtual machines. An initial test case has been performed by modelling the policies to be executed by a solver that demonstrates the applicability of our proposal for saving energy and also guaranteeing the QoS. The proposed policy has been implemented using the OpenStack software and the obtained results showed that energy consumption can be significantly lowered by applying GreenC to allocate virtual machines to physical hosts.
